Abstract

The utility model discloses a multi-layer conveying device for different materials. The multi-layer conveying device comprises a conveying corridor (1), one or more horizontal baffle plates (2) are arranged in the conveying corridor (1), the baffle plates (2) vertically separate the conveying corridor (1) into two or more conveying channels (3), and belt conveyors (4) are installed in each conveying channel (3). The multi-layer conveying device can solve the problem of large land area occupied by the conveying equipment, and simultaneously is favorable for the layout of underground pipelines of a factory and for the reduction of equipment investment.

Background technology
The belt conveyor corridor is one of structures that adopt in the commercial production maximum transported materials, in Aluminium Electrolysis, there are multiple raw materials for production to need the belt conveyor corridor to be transported to workshop from raw material store, and transportation volume is big, and present belt conveyor corridor is and can only carries a kind of material, therefore need a plurality of belt conveyors of configuration corridor to transport different material, make that the belt conveyor corridor takes up an area of greatly, construction investment is high.When the belt conveyor corridor of different material is positioned at the same passage of plant area, will occupy a large amount of positions, make the land used anxiety of plant area's channel range, for guaranteeing the layout of underground utilities, have to strengthen plant area's passage width, the land area of factory is increased, be unfavorable for the reasonable use in soil.

The specific embodiment
Embodiment: the utility model as depicted in figs. 1 and 2, during concrete enforcement, can make up with steel structure or with ferro-concrete on the ground earlier and support 6, make up when supporting, the spacing that supports remains between 15~30 meters according to the situation of landform and load, the height that supports is when crossing over factory road or railway, and its minimum clear headroom should be greater than 4.5 meters or 7 meters.Support can adopt the support 7 of " door " type or " X " type to support 8 according to the load of convey materials.Use with board making then and carry vestibule 1, the material kind number that the height of conveying vestibule is carried as required is separated into multilayer with horizontal baffle 2, but the number of plies is also unsuitable too many, the number of plies is too many, carry the height of vestibule too high, can influence carry the stability of vestibule and the cost of manufacture of carrying vestibule, be generally 2~4 layers and be advisable.The clear headroom of each transfer passage 3 after separating with dividing plate 2 should satisfy the requirement of maintenance, greater than 2.2 meters; By a side band conveyor 4 is installed in the transfer passage 3, should be reserved access path 5 at the opposite side of band conveyor 4, the width of access path should be greater than 1 meter.Satisfy the current and inspection operation of personnel.Carry the top of vestibule 1 to adopt flat slope top, single face oblique top or top, " people " word slope, be beneficial to draining by the local climate condition.
